What Is Hypertension?

Hypertension (high blood pressure) is the diagnosis given when readings consis-

tently rise above normal. It is well known that hypertension can lead to stroke,

heart attack or other illness if left untreated. Referred to as a “silent killer” because

it does not always produce symptoms that alert you to the problem, hypertension

is treatable when diagnosed early.

Can Hypertension Be Controlled?

Why Measure Blood Pressure at Home?

It is now well known that, for many individuals, blood pressure readings taken in

a doctor’s office or hospital setting might be elevated as a result of apprehension

and anxiety. This response is commonly called “white coat hypertension.”
In any case, self-measurement at home supplements your doctor’s readings and

provides a more accurate, complete blood pressure history. In addition, clinical

studies have shown that the detection and treatment of hypertension is improved

when patients both consult their physicians and monitor their own blood pressure

at home.
